## Releases

Pagesmith's template rendering engine is released monthly. Each release includes benchmark results comparing render times against the prior version; support can cite these when customers report slowdowns. Hotfixes for performance regressions skip the monthly cycle and ship immediately. All builds are signed before distribution, and support tooling verifies signatures automatically. For manual verification of a customer-supplied build, use the signing key below.

deploy key for kajof-fajop: bky6_gDHw9Q

## Configuration

StormFan relays severe-weather alerts from the Gustline feed to regional pager queues. Set FANOUT_REGIONS to a comma-separated list and FANOUT_MAX_RETRIES (default 3). If retries exhaust, alerts land in the dead-letter queue; drain it manually. All settings live in `.env` on the dispatch host. Add the Gustline signing secret on the next line.

sealed setting: ARCHIVE_KEY3=8d0

- [ ] Step 7: Archive cold storage buckets (Glacierline tier). Confirm both ceremony witnesses are present, verify bucket manifests match the Oxbow ledger, then seal the archive key shares. Plugin authors may observe but not handle shares. Once sealed, the archive index itself is encrypted and can only be reopened with the passphrase below.

vault phrase of badup-hahig = tamael-aldael-kelmir-istael-fenok-istwyn-tamius-jorath-oliion

Hey Tomasz — handing this one to you before I head off. The water samples from the Gellbrook reservoir are in the chilled locker by the dispatch desk, twelve bottles, all labelled and logged. The lab at Strayfield needs them within 24 hours or the whole run is wasted, so the Quickhaven courier booked for 08:15 is non-negotiable. Cooler packs are already swapped, paperwork's in the sleeve on top. When the driver shows up, just follow the hand-over instruction below.

dispatch memo: the quenvan holax courier leaves the zoreth briath kasvan ledger at gate 7481 under passcode 618862